I was just wondering with all the trades that happened why did Christian get stuck on ECW?

As I reported exclusively on Wrestling News World Premium on June 18th, despite being quietly praised amongst the entire locker room as being the top worker in the company right now, the plan is for Christian to remain on ECW for the foreseeable future. Some blame Vince McMahon's immaturity for holding him back because he left for TNA and became a bigger star. The feeling is it will pass and Christian will end up a top star on either Raw or SmackDown.

Were you at all surprised that Chris Jericho and Edge were added to the Unified Tag Match at the Bash? Honestly, I really wanted to see an Edge and Christian reunion, especially after Edge came out first.

We were told the decision for Chris Jericho and Edge to capture the Unified Tag Team Championship was a last-minute change, so yes, I was surprised. Obviously the move helps restore a little more prestige to the tag division and gives Cody Rhodes and Ted DiBiase an excellent opportunity to work with two of the most established workers in the business. The reason for unifying the tag titles was to create more action in the tag division and with Jericho and Edge going over, it does just that. Were tickets from last week's Raw really refunded?

Yes, WWE issued refunds to everyone that purchased a ticket for last week's edition of Raw. There was a process you had to go through to get your money back, but it was legitimate and not kayfabe. Plenty of workers were surprised WWE would refund ticket money with the weak state of the economy.

Where is William Regal?

William Regal was moved to ECW in last night's mini Draft. Regal's stock fell immensely after failing his second WWE Wellness Test last year. They may re-build him on ECW, but that is why he has been used as a mid-card worker on Raw.
